Transcription factor Sp7 is a protein that in humans is encoded by the SP7 gene.[1][2]

SP7 is a C2H2-type zinc finger transcription factor of the SP gene family and a putative master regulator of osteoblast differentiation (Gao et al., 2004).[supplied by OMIM][2]
